Please note that currently the folder where the "Recently closed" tabs are stored is the following
%localappdata%\Chromium\User Data\Default\Sessions
then in order to delete them it is enough to empty that folder.

Re: SRWare Iron Browser issue
You need to clean two items in the SRWare Iron section: Stored Session Commands and Stored Tabs Commands instead.
